Micki Katz, with a background in creative operations management and technology implementation, currently serves as the Digital Asset Manager at Molson Coors Beverage Company. In this role, she ensures that approved marketing content is readily accessible and easily discoverable for its extensive network of distributors and partners in the USA and globally. Micki’s focus has been to establish a robust taxonomy that would be scalable and facilitate integration with other business systems particularly Product Information Management (PIM).

Helen is the Archivist (Digital Preservation) at The Postal Museum. She has overseen the procurement and implementation of a digital preservation system for The Postal Museum’s born-digital museum and archive collections. In January 2026 The Postal Museum launched its Digital Collections Portal to provide online public access to the born-digital collections for the first time. Other areas for work include user service and Equity, Equality, Diversity and Inclusion, which inform the digital preservation activities.

Viktor Mayer-Schönberger is professor of internet governance and regulation at the University of Oxford. He is the (co)author of over a dozen books, including the awards winning “Delete”, “Reinventing Capitalism”, and “Framers”, as well as the international bestseller “Big Data”. Science called his recent book “Guardrails” a “must read.” His work on data access has influenced national and EU legislation.

In addition to teaching and research, he advises governments, international organizations, and corporations on the role (and governance) of data.
